#d1dbd2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d1dbd2 is composed of 82% red, 85.9%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 4.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 4.1% yellow and 14.1% black. It has a hue angle of 126 degrees, a saturation of 12.2% and a lightness of 83.9%. #d1dbd2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a3b7a5.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

● #d1dbd2 color description : Light grayish lime green.
#d1dbd2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d1dbd2 has RGB values of R:209, G:219, B:210 and CMYK values of C:0.05, M:0, Y:0.04, K:0.14. Its decimal value is 13753298.

Shades and Tints of #d1dbd2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070907 is the darkest color, while #fdfdf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#d1dbd2
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#d4d8d5 is the less saturated color, while #aefeb6 is the most saturated one.
